Mercurial > repos > drosofff > msp_blastparser_and_hits
comparison BlastParser_and_hits.py @ 5:a0dec1a0f2ef draft
planemo upload for repository https://github.com/ARTbio/tools-artbio/tree/master/tools/msp_blastparser_and_hits commit 59dcca02907c91f852e63db16acd72c9d79d6eb2
author | drosofff |
---|---|
date | Fri, 15 Jan 2016 12:51:19 -0500 |
parents | 60b6bd959929 |
children | 78c34df2dd8d |
comparison
equal
deleted
inserted
replaced
4:60b6bd959929 | 5:a0dec1a0f2ef |
---|---|
129 leftCoordinate = 1 | 129 leftCoordinate = 1 |
130 return getseq (fastadict, FastaHeader, leftCoordinate, rightCoordinate, polarity) | 130 return getseq (fastadict, FastaHeader, leftCoordinate, rightCoordinate, polarity) |
131 | 131 |
132 def outputParsing (F, Fasta, results, Xblastdict, fastadict, filter_relativeCov=0, filter_maxScore=0, filter_meanScore=0, filter_term_in="", filter_term_out="", mode="verbose"): | 132 def outputParsing (F, Fasta, results, Xblastdict, fastadict, filter_relativeCov=0, filter_maxScore=0, filter_meanScore=0, filter_term_in="", filter_term_out="", mode="verbose"): |
133 def filter_results (results, filter_relativeCov=0, filter_maxScore=0, filter_meanScore=0, filter_term_in="", filter_term_out=""): | 133 def filter_results (results, filter_relativeCov=0, filter_maxScore=0, filter_meanScore=0, filter_term_in="", filter_term_out=""): |
134 print "###", filter_term_in | |
135 for subject in results.keys(): | 134 for subject in results.keys(): |
136 if results[subject]["RelativeSubjectCoverage"]<filter_relativeCov: | 135 if results[subject]["RelativeSubjectCoverage"]<filter_relativeCov: |
137 del results[subject] | 136 del results[subject] |
138 continue | 137 continue |
139 if results[subject]["maxBitScores"]<filter_maxScore: | 138 if results[subject]["maxBitScores"]<filter_maxScore: |